Ad Hominem argument is a type of informal argumentation fallacy, in which the speaker refers to the characteristics of the opponent or the circumstances in which the opponent is, and not to the opinions recognized by the opponent or arguments of the opponent. Examples of different behaviors motivated by this fallacy are racism, homophobia or xenophobia, in which people dislike other people because of particular characteristics, but not because of their ideals or personality.
